RAFFLE DRUMS — STAFF PARTY (notes, Thursday stand-up)

- Two brass raffle drums hired from Pellworth Party Supply for the Midwinter do at the Arbory Hall.
- Delivery Friday, 10:00, via Swifthaven Couriers. Office manager signs.
- Drums are antiques; hire contract requires padded storage, no stacking.
- Return pickup Monday 09:00 sharp — late return doubles the fee.
- Keep the hire paperwork in the events folder.
- Swifthaven's driver is under instruction to hand over only on hearing the release phrase given below.

handover note for yagef-bagep: the drudor pelius courier leaves the kasdor zorvan norir ledger at gate 8016 under passcode 755406

If Ledgerpeek (our audit-log viewer) starts timing out, first check the index lag panel — nine times out of ten it's the nightly compaction job hogging the cluster. Restart the viewer pods only if lag is under five minutes; otherwise you'll just make it worse. To query the backing store directly, hit the Quillbase internal API from the jumpbox. Use the key below to authenticate.

gateway credential: kto3_qfe

## Deployment

Welcome aboard. The Tindervale catalog service relies on aggressive edge caching, so deploys must always be paired with an invalidation pass. After the new build is live, the deploy script publishes an invalidation event per changed SKU; the edge nodes then refetch on next request. Never invalidate the whole namespace manually — it stampedes the origin. If a deploy stalls mid-invalidation, re-run the script; it is idempotent. Before your first deploy, verify that your environment matches the production configuration shown below:

settings of tagef-bawif:
DRUIX_HOST=druix.zemvarlabs.internal
DRUIX_PORT=8000

Handing off the Tumblebox locker flow before I rotate off. Current state: unlock-by-code works, but the grace-period logic after a missed pickup is half-done — the timer fires but the re-lock event sometimes double-sends. Quirin started a fix on the `relock-debounce` branch; please review before merging. Also, the kiosk firmware caches stale locker states for ~30s, which explains most "ghost occupied" reports. Everything else I know is written up on the internal page below.

wiki page, kagep-bajog: https://sentry.braskdata.internal/issue